Frequently Asked Questions about Delray Beach
How much are Studio apartments in Delray Beach?
There are currently 108 Studio Apartments in Delray Beach with rent ranges from $1,825 to $3,244 with an average price of $2,248.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Delray Beach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Delray Beach ranges from $1,550 to $4,383 with an average monthly rent of $2,431.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Delray Beach c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Delray Beach range from $1,750 to $6,365.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,958.
How expensive are Delray Beach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 111 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Delray Beach on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,250 to $7,835 - averaging $3,438 for the location.
